MANGALURU: City police is yet to take a decision on granting permission for organizers to hold religious meet involving Indian Islamic preacher Zakir Naik as main speaker.
An orgnisation has approached city police commissioner S Murugan seeking permission to hold religious meet in Mangaluru city with Zakir Naik as main speaker. In the meantime, saffron outfits have raised objections through social media alleging that the programme may affect the social harmony in the region.

When asked, Murugan told reporters that an organization has applied for permission to hold programme at Nehru Maidan in the city on January 3. “We have received an application from an organization for permission to hold Zakir Naik’s talk in the city. However, they have not mentioned the details of the programme. Hence, I have sought more details of the programme including the theme of his speech. We will take a decision based on their reply,” Murugan said.
Further, Murugan said that as of now no cases have been booked against Zakir Naik in any of the stations in Mangaluru. “We only know that he is a religious speaker on TV and other programmes. We do not know if he has spoken against other religions. As far as we know, his speeches, by and large, are centered on Islam and Quran. We will verify all aspects and decide on granting permission for his programme,” Murugan added.
